Suspension laryngoscopy presents significant challenges for airway management due to the need to maintain adequate ventilation while providing optimal surgical exposure. Flow-controlled ventilation (FCV) is a novel ventilation mode that delivers constant inspiratory and expiratory flow using a narrow-lumen, cuffed endotracheal tube, potentially improving ventilation efficiency in shared-airway surgeries.
This prospective observational study aims to compare flow-controlled ventilation and conventional volume-controlled ventilation in patients undergoing elective suspension laryngoscopy. Respiratory mechanics, hemodynamic parameters, perioperative pulmonary function, and procedure-related complications will be evaluated to assess the feasibility and clinical performance of FCV in this surgical setting.
